Calculate and send the missing transferred_size and content_size to dev tools (#38216)

The current behaviour in dev tools network monitor is missing data for
the `Transferred` size and `Content` size.
We currently have a fn `response_content` that constructs the
`ResponseContentMsg` struct where the two missing data fields are
defined and set to zero values.
These current changes calculates the data in the `response_content` fn
and sends a `NetworkEvent::HttpResponse` to the client when the final
body is done.
Currently, we have data appearing in the `Transferred` column of the
network panel
fixes: https://github.com/servo/servo/issues/38126
